一般描述

三磷酸腺苷(ATP)是一种仅在线粒体内形成的三磷酸核苷。这是一种高能分子,被称为所有生命系统的能量货币。包含在ATP的磷酸键中的化学能量驱动着大多数的细胞过程。[1][2]诸如Leber遗传性视神经病变、[2]Leigh综合征、神经病、共济失调以及色素性视网膜炎[3]等遗传疾病都会影响线粒体内的ATP生成。

应用

ATP检测试剂盒已用于通过对样本中ATP的荧光检测而对ATP浓度进行量化。[4]

适用性

适于测定不同样品中的ATP,如动物组织和细胞培养样品。

原理

ATP比色/荧光检测试剂盒是一种用于测定各种样品中ATP的灵敏检测(比色检测为2-10 nmole/孔而荧光检测为20-1,000 pmole/孔)。ATP的浓度是通过磷酸化甘油而测定,可产生与存在的ATP量成比例的比色(570 nm)或荧光(lex = 535/lem = 587 nm)产物。

其他说明

荧光检测比比色检测具有10-100倍更高的灵敏度。
